AverageiHow is the EPC score calculated?
The score (1–100) is the property's energy efficiency rating, produced by an accredited Domestic Energy Assessor using the UK Government's Standard Assessment Procedure (SAP). A higher score means a more energy-efficient home that's cheaper to run.
It's calculated from the property's physical characteristics, including:
- Size & floor area
- Construction & age
- Wall, roof & floor insulation
- Windows / glazing
- Main heating & controls
- Hot water & lighting
These are the factors shown in the certificates above. The score maps to a band — A (92–100, most efficient) down to G(1–20). The "potential" score is what could be achieved with the recommended improvements. Source: MHCLG EPC Register.
